Correction Process

  1. Updating a Report
    • If an article requires an update, we revise the content accordingly.
    • A correction note is added to indicate the changes made.
    • Any significant modifications are highlighted at the top of the article.
  2. Corrections
    • If a factual error is found, we correct the mistake and publish a clarification.
    • A correction notice is issued to explain the nature of the change.
  3. Clarifications
    • If an article’s language is unclear or misleading, we make necessary revisions for better comprehension.
    • Clarifications are issued if key stakeholder comments were omitted initially and later added.
  4. Editor’s Notes
    • If an error significantly impacts the story’s integrity, an editor’s note is added.
    • This note explains the issue and ensures full transparency.

Take-down Requests As a standard policy, Jankari Desk does not entertain take-down requests. However, if an error is identified, we are committed to investigating and making necessary corrections. Updates or follow-ups may be published if fairness requires additional coverage. We do not remove published articles unless there is a significant legal or ethical obligation to do so.

Social Media Corrections If an error is found in content shared on social media platforms, we promptly correct it and retract the incorrect information if editing is not possible.
